About Ministry of Sound Classical

Ministry of Sound Classical is a groundbreaking project that bridges the gap between the pulsating energy of electronic dance music and the timeless elegance of classical composition. Born from the legendary Ministry of Sound club, renowned globally for its pioneering role in dance music culture, this initiative seeks to honour the genre’s most beloved tracks by reinterpreting them with orchestral force. The concept began as a way to celebrate the 25th anniversary of Ministry of Sound, showcasing how the music that filled dance floors for decades could resonate with an entirely new sonic palette.

The ensemble features a full symphony orchestra, meticulously arranging and performing tracks that have become synonymous with clubbing history. These aren’t simple cover versions; each piece is a thoughtful re-imagining, dissecting the electronic layers and melodic hooks to reconstruct them with the rich textures, soaring strings, and powerful brass of an orchestra. The result is a breathtakingly dynamic performance that respects the original tracks while injecting them with an entirely new level of emotional depth and dramatic flair.

Ministry of Sound Classical has captivated audiences worldwide with its innovative approach. Their repertoire draws from a deep well of dance music history, featuring anthems from the likes of Fatboy Slim, The Chemical Brothers, Daft Punk, Underworld, and many more. Tracks such as “Right Here, Right Now,” “Galvanize,” “One More Time,” and “Born Slippy .NUXX” are transformed into symphonic masterpieces, their iconic riffs and driving rhythms amplified by the orchestral power. This project has successfully proven that electronic dance music, often perceived as purely functional, possesses a profound melodic and structural complexity that lends itself beautifully to orchestral interpretation. Their performances are a testament to the enduring legacy of these tracks and their ability to transcend genre, connecting with listeners on a visceral and emotional level through the universal language of music.
